On November 16th, 2011. Pearl Jam came to Santiago, Chile (Estadio Monumental).
I had purchased a ticket to "cancha", to be as close as possible. 
The day before, I arrived at the stadium near 4 in the afternoon with Ariel. We took a blanket and food for the night.
When we reached the stadium, there were few people, but while the time passed by, people were joining until we were 20 or 30.
At night a group of us, was playing the guitar and we (me and Ariel) were listening. Also, occasionally we could heard the openning act's rehearsal. 
Near 12 am, the containment fence was installed.
I don't know how much time I slept, but I wasn't sleepy. 
People began to arrive at 10 am (more or less).
Within which we slept outside the stadium there was a group of three that were taking turns. All was good, but as the day progressed, we realized that they were leaking a lot of people that were making the row outside the gates of containment. Then we knew that they were ten club chile's members and their plan was to leak the rest of the members (at least 20 person).It was a situation that led to a little discussion.
It was increasingly people, Lucas (a friend's brother) had joined to us. We remained sat, glued to the front gate of the stadium, right in the door that would open.
Later, when the doors were about to be opened, the guards were all in their places, also the people who cut tickets. The excitement and anxiety felt in the air. I was in front of the gates, standing, I was the first.
Doors were opened (at last), Ariel did back pressure so that people would not fall on me and I ran like I've never ever done before. They cut my ticket and then I kept running, a couple of people left me behind, but there were few. I continued running and I got to the gate in front of the stage, was just in front of the microphone that Eddie Vedder would use later. Out of breath, I leaned and they gave me water.
I enjoyed the whole concert in the front row.
It was an amazing experience.
